DataPath and Konan Digital Offer Advanced MAM System for Military, Homeland Security and News Broadc

Partnership Enables Secure, Real-Time Access, Processing and Distribution of Video for Both Intelligence and News Broadcast Purp.

LAS VEGAS, April 24 /PRNewswire/ — NAB 2006 Conference Booth #Sl1835 — DataPath, Inc., a global solution provider for mission-critical communications, and Konan Digital Inc., an innovative developer of media asset management solutions, have formed an OEM partnership that offers DataPath’s commercial and government customers an improved way to produce and manage high-quality video. The new DataPath Software Media Asset Management(TM) solution provides a more cost-effective, user-friendly and automated alternative to manual tape processes and older, cost-prohibitive video asset management systems.

DataPath will offer Konan media asset management software to commercial news broadcasting customers, and also plans to optimize and extend the solution to meet the requirements of both Department of Defense and Homeland Security customers.

“We can now expand the value of our communications networks to include digital media asset management,” said Stephen Lindeman, general manager of DataPath Software. “Without an effective way to speed and automate the processing of video assets, military, civilian government and news broadcast organizations lack the real-time capabilities they need to gain a decisive advantage or competitive edge. As a step forward, DataPath plans to adapt the Konan software to help the warfighter obtain, analyze and disseminate video to gain information superiority.”
